
Dr. Barbara Smith, the Barbour County author and editor of some twenty books, has recently published a new novel with the title, Family Court.
“This time it’s a real mystery”, Smith says. “The blurb on the back cover describes the situation: Before the vengeful killing of three-year-old Little Tim, the lives of Family Court Judge Tim Bennett and his family were relatively normal. Now…”
Smith’s novel is located in West Virginia, the setting for most of her books.
